To reset the Hoover DYN9164DPG L1-80, unplug the machine from the power outlet, wait for about 1 minute, and then plug it back in. This often resolves minor electronic glitches.
First, ensure that the door is firmly closed. Check that the power cord is plugged in and that there's power to the outlet. Verify that the water supply taps are turned on. If the issue persists, consult the user manual for further troubleshooting steps.
To clean the filter, locate it at the bottom front of the machine. Turn it counterclockwise to remove, clean it under running water, and then replace it securely by turning clockwise.
Check if there is an obstruction preventing the door from closing completely. Ensure the door latch is engaging properly. If the error persists, it may indicate a faulty door lock mechanism that might require professional repair.
Use a commercial washing machine descaler or a mixture of white vinegar and baking soda. Run an empty cycle at the highest temperature to remove limescale buildup. Always refer to the user manual for specific recommendations.
Ensure the washing machine is level by adjusting the feet. Avoid overloading the drum and distribute the laundry evenly. Check for any transit bolts that may not have been removed during installation.
Regularly clean the detergent drawer, filter, and drum. Inspect hoses for leaks or wear and ensure the machine is level to prevent excessive noise or movement.
Check the drain hose for kinks or blockages. Clean the pump filter to remove any debris. If these steps do not resolve the issue, there may be an internal fault that requires professional repair.
Run a maintenance wash with an empty load using a washing machine cleaner or a hot cycle with vinegar. Clean the door seal and leave the door slightly open between uses to allow air circulation.
Ensure clothes are evenly distributed in the drum. Do not overload the machine. Use the appropriate amount of detergent and select the right wash cycle based on fabric type and soil level.
